Costs range from $200 to $1,000 per rental, depending on dumpster size, duration, and waste type. Additional fees may apply for exceeding weight limits or hazardous waste disposal.

You can cut costs and expedite the process of junk removal by following a few essential steps. Use these methods to save on junk removal costs:

  • Sorting items and debris into one area to reduce sorting costs. 

  • Contacting local charities or donation centers for free or reduced-cost pickup of donations.

  • For tree-related items like branches, advertise to community members looking for free firewood.

  • Conduct one large clean-out instead of many smaller ones to reduce materials and labor costs.

The best way to determine the best dumpster size for your project is to speak with the dumpster rental company. These professionals have specific experience with fitting heavy and bulky items in their dumpsters and how to dispose of each item safely and legally. In most cases, the dumpster company will err on the side of caution and advise you to size up to avoid overage charges.

The cost to demolish a single-wide mobile home ranges from $3,000 to $5,000, including debris disposal. A double-wide mobile home will cost $4,000 to $7,000 to demolish and remove debris.
